Philip White Hall was born in 1918 in Weston, Lewis, West Virginia, USA, the child of Claude Monroe Hall And Nellie White. In 1930, Philip White Hall resided in Freemans Creek, Lewis, West Virginia, USA. In 1935, Philip White Hall resided in Freemans Creek, Lewis, West Virginia. Philip White Hall married Betty Lavonne Stutler, and had children including Hall. Philip White Hall passed away in 1972 in Forest Lawn Memorial Gardens, Jane Lew, Lewis, West Virginia, USA.
